Block 5638643

0xcc9181f573ed5b80c28ba66aa41db56ef74ec374009976cb67d332db4adf8194
Transactions0
Height5638643
Confirmations15030382
TimestampFri, 30 Mar 2018 19:25:36 UTC
Size (bytes)534
Version
Merkle Root
Nonce0xe2a192333b553d97
Bits
Difficulty0x98b3949e7c12